Darien Cracks Top 5 In Final Field Hockey Coaches Poll

The Blue Wave won the FCIAC tournament, then advanced to the Class L semifinals in 2018.

DARIEN, CT — Despite being eliminated in the Class L semifinals, an FCIAC tournament championship helped propel Darien High School to fifth among voters in the final field hockey coaches poll for 2018.

The Blue Wave handed eventual Class L champion Staples its only loss of the season in the finals of the FCIAC tournament.

Staples was first in the balloting, receiving all eight first-place votes, while Class S champion Immaculate was second, Class L runner-up Cheshire was third and Class M titlist Guilford wound up fourth.

Here are the top 10, plus all other teams receiving votes.

  1. Staples
  2. Immaculate
  3. Cheshire
  4. Guilford
  5. Darien
  6. Granby Memorial
  7. Stonington
  8. Sacred Heart Academy
  9. Newtown
  10. Avon

Also receiving votes: Norwalk, Daniel Hand, Pomperaug, Hall, Wilton.
